Abstract
Objective To study the influence of the blood coagulation function and bleeding of different application methods of tranexamic acid for patients with total hip arthroplasty(THA).Methods Total 105 cases patients with THA were divided into observation group (n=53) and the control group (n=52): control group was given tranexamic acid 20 mg/kg+100 ml saline intravenous drip within 15 min before cutting skin.Observation group was given 20 mg/kg tranexamic acid by articular cavity injection during THA,and the difference of blood coagulation function and the bleeding were compared between the two groups.Results Activated partial prothrombin time(APTT) and fibrinogen (FIB),prothrombin time(PT)of observation group were lower than the control group,APTT,FIB,PT were compared between two groups,with no statistically significant difference (P>0.05).The volume of drainage,total blood loss and hidden blood loss of observation group were significantly less than control group,compared with statistically significant differences (P<0.001).Postoperative Hb levels of two groups patients were significantly lower than preoperation,there was significant difference (P<0.05),Hb levels of observation group were obviously higher than control group,postoperative Hb reducing volume and blood transfusion volume were obviously less than control group,there was significant difference (P<0.001).Blood transfusion rate of 7.55% in observation group was obviously lower than control group of 21.15%,compared with significant difference (P<0.05).Two groups patients had no pulmonary embolism,deep vein thrombosis incidence rate of observation group was 3.77%,control group was 7.69%,they were compared between two groups,with no statistical significance(P>0.05).Conclusions Articular cavity applying tranexamic acid during THA can reduce blood loss,and obviously decrease blood transfusion rate,and can not affect blood coagulation function or increase deep vein thrombosis risk.关键词
